Master artist and storyteller David Kirk is hailed as one of today’s most innovative and exciting creators of books, toys, and products for children. Before his remarkable success in the world of children’s publishing, Kirk was the fouder and designer of two toy companies, Ovicular Toyworks and Hoobert Toys. His bright, hand-painted wooden toys (including multi-colored robots inspired by his boyhood collection) have been sold around the world and are, together with his paintings and handcrafted furniture, treasured by collectors and featured in books, art galleries, and museums.

In 1996, David Kirk and Nicholas Callaway co-founded Callaway & Kirk Company, which creates and produces original children’s characters and stories for all media.

David Kirk lives in the Finger Lakes region of New York with his wife, Kathy, and his daughters, Violet, Primrose, and Wisteria.
